Botox, or Botulinum toxin type A, is a neurotoxin produced by the bacterium Clostridium botulinum. While it’s often associated with cosmetic enhancements—like reducing wrinkles—it also has various medical applications. But how safe is it really?

Understanding Botox: The Basics

  • What is Botox?
  • Botox is a purified form of botulinum toxin that temporarily paralyzes muscles. It blocks nerve signals that cause muscle contractions.
  • Historical Background
  • Initially approved for treating medical conditions like strabismus (crossed eyes) and blepharospasm (eyelid spasms), it was later discovered that Botox could effectively reduce facial wrinkles.

The Injection Process: What to Anticipate The Procedure Duration

  • How Long Does It Take?
  • Typically, treatment sessions last 10-30 minutes depending on the areas being treated.

Pain Management Techniques

  • Is It Painful?
  • Most clients describe the sensation as mild discomfort; numbing creams may be offered if necessary.

Aftercare Following Botox Injections in Warrington Immediate Post-Procedure Tips

  • What Should You Avoid?
  • For 24 hours post-treatment, avoid strenuous exercise, lying down, or touching the treated area.
  • Managing Side Effects
  • Mild swelling or bruising may occur but usually resolves within days.

Duration of Results: How Long Will It Last? Expected Longevity of Effects

  • When to Expect Results?
  • Results typically manifest within 3-7 days after injection.
  • How Long Do They Last?
  • Effects generally last 3-6 months before another treatment session might be needed.

Potential Risks and Side Effects of Botox Treatments in Warrington Common Side Effects

  • Mild Reactions

    • These can include temporary swelling or redness at the injection site.
  • Rare Complications

    • In very rare cases, patients might experience drooping eyelids or asymmetry.
Understanding Serious Risks
  • When Should You Seek Help?
    • If you experience difficulty swallowing or breathing post-injection, immediate medical attention is essential.
FAQs About Botox Safety

Q1: How safe is Botox for everyone?

 

A: While generally safe for most adults, individuals with certain neurological conditions should consult their doctors beforehand.

 

Q2: Are there any contraindications for getting Botox injections in Warrington?

 

A: Yes! Pregnant women or those with specific allergies should avoid this treatment unless cleared by a healthcare professional.
